Whoopi Goldberg only wants to do ‘Sister Act 3’ with Maggie Smith

Whoopi Goldberg has begged her colleague Dame Maggie Smith to participate in the third installment in the Sister Act series. The leading actress made her plea on Friday on the British talk show Loose Women.

The now 88-year-old Maggie played the role of Mother Superior in the previous two films. “We can’t do it without you,” Whoopi pleaded on the talk show. “Tell us what we have to do to convince you, this role is and will remain yours.” Whoopi herself played the role of lounge singer Deloris, who started a new life as a nun.

The first Sister Act movie was released in 1992 and was immediately very successful. The second part, Sister Act 2: Back In The Habit, was released a year later. This film also attracted many visitors to the cinema. In December 2020, it was announced that a third part is in the works for Disney +. It is not yet clear when the film will be released.
